# 远程文件浏览器 Netfiles **Repository Path**: baiqitun/netfiles ## Basic Information - **Project Name**: 远程文件浏览器 Netfiles - **Description**: No description available - **Primary Language**: Unknown - **License**: MulanPSL-2.0 -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 2 - **Forks**: 1 - **Created**: 2020-11-27 - **Last Updated**: 2022-03-30 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 远程文件浏览器 版本 1.1.2 ### 环境 * Java 8+ * Redis 3+ ### 介绍 NetFiles远程文件浏览器是一款小巧的远程文件浏览器,将它部署到服务器后,客户端可拥有远程浏览服务器文件的能力。 ### 特性 ##### 跨平台 基于Java,可支持Linux、Windows、Mac OS等系统 前端使用 **BootStrap** 框架实现,同时支持PC端和移动端访问。 ##### 安全 应用主键路径映射,不暴露真实路径给客户端。 ##### 快速部署 直接运行命令启动即可 ```shell java -jar netfiles.jar ``` 的命令启动本项目。 如需进行后台启动请自行查找对应系统的后台启动方式 ##### 支持多种浏览模式(可在顶部导航进行模式切换) * 普通文件浏览模式 默认浏览模式 * 图片浏览模式 可以连续图片的方式浏览整个目录下的图片 ### 使用说明 确保系统安装了JAVA 8及以上版本 1. 在 **application.yml**中配置**netfiles**的**root**项 root项就是浏览器可查看哪些目录,可配置多个目录。 2. 运行命令 **java -jar netfiles.jar** 3. 启动后打开浏览器,输入地址 *http://localhost:8888/netfiles* 即可访问 ### 支持的文件格式 视频格式 **mav** **mp4** **webm** **flav** 图片格式 **jpg** **png** **gif** **bmp**